Transaction 839c077098896bf9d7eed00e34e6a305a1f183660dfd4eb40a8ee543d504657a

2 Input
2 Outputs
  • 839c077098896bf9d7eed00e34e6a305a1f183660dfd4eb40a8ee543d504657a:0
  • value  57966
    address  1JM8ntLLRtP1jmpcXWAG7NRgUJgVupX9mH
  • 839c077098896bf9d7eed00e34e6a305a1f183660dfd4eb40a8ee543d504657a:1
  • value  627
    address  bc1qm4qagwenj0x87709gn34f7z6y8c250yxhfh7lq